Moroccan dirham (MAD, symbol: د.م.)

Tangier is budget-friendly versus many Mediterranean cities. Riads, casual meals, and local taxis are affordable, while upscale hotels and tourist restaurants cost more.

Average meal costs

Budget
30-60 MAD for street food or a simple meal.
Mid-range
100-200 MAD per person for a restaurant meal.
Fine dining
250+ MAD per person at upscale restaurants.
Coffee
12-25 MAD for coffee or cappuccino.

Tipping culture

Restaurants: 5-10% if service is not included. Cafes: round up or leave a few dirhams. Taxis: round up the fare or add about 5 MAD for helpful service.

Tangier is outside the Schengen Area. Travelers departing from Seville will need a valid passport and may require a visa depending on their nationality. Entry and visa requirements can be subject to change. For the latest information, check with your destination's embassy or consulate.

The currency used in Morocco is the Moroccan Dirham (MAD). Travelers often find it convenient to use cash for smaller purchases and markets, while cards are widely accepted in hotels, restaurants, and larger stores, making a combination of both payment methods ideal.
In Tangier, travelers should be cautious of aggressive street vendors and unofficial guides who may pressure for tips or fees. Common scams include inflated taxi fares, so always agree on a price beforehand or insist on using the meter. Pickpocketing can occur in crowded areas, especially near markets and transportation hubs, so keeping valuables secure is important. Avoid isolated areas at night and be wary of overly friendly strangers offering unsolicited help.
